**Your new role**:
This exciting newly-created opportunity supports the Workforce Strategy and Business Partnering team, within the People function, by producing high-quality workforce data, reports, and analysis. As the People Data and Reporting Analyst, you will work within a collaborative and dynamic team, helping to implement a brand-new people analytics tool into business to produce insightful workforce data and insights. Your work will focus on enhancing data quality, ensuring accurate capture of people data, while providing advice and guidance on best practices for people data management, integrity, and reporting.

**Key Responsibilities**:

- Provide advice and guidance on best practice people data management, integrity and reporting.
- Collaborate within the team to identify and develop customised reporting and dashboards of workforce metrics.
- Conduct in depth analysis of People data to identify trends, correlations, and areas of greatest risk, providing targeted insights to team and business.
- Support data requirements aligned to business unit workforce plans, strategic objectives and broader business workforce strategies.
- Act as a technical data steward and support data advocacy through data audits to ensure ongoing data integrity and compliance.

With over $70B in funds under management, CSC has provided superannuation services to employees of the Australian Government and members of the Australian Defence Force for over 100 years. We are proud to serve those who serve Australia.

Every day, CSC makes a real difference by guiding our customers to make the right choices, and to feel confident about their financial wellbeing.
